Legal fees in auto accident cases usually depend on the complexity of your claim. Factors that influence the final cost include the extent of your medical bills, the number of parties involved, and whether the case requires a lengthy trial or settles early during negotiations. Most firms operate on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than upfront hourly billing. Key evidence includes the official police report, witness statements, photographs of the accident scene and vehicle damage, and detailed medical records documenting your injuries and treatment. Any dashcam footage or surveillance from businesses in Salem can also be highly valuable.
An accident lawyer investigates your collision, gathers all necessary documentation, and negotiates with insurance adjusters on your behalf. If a fair settlement isn't reached, they are prepared to represent you in court. They manage all legal complexities.
Avoid admitting fault for the accident or discussing the full extent of your injuries without consulting your attorney first. Stick to the factual details of the collision. Your lawyer will guide you on what information is most critical to share and when.
